Asia-Pacific is currently the largest market; U.S. is the largest market in North America
PUNE, India — The global shell and tube heat exchangers market is forecast to grow from $5.29 billion in 2015 to $7.05 billion by 2020, at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 4.98 percent, according to a new report published by MarketsandMarkets.
The market is being driven by the surging need for energy and high investment in chemicals, petrochemicals and the oil and gas industries. Among the regions considered, Asia-Pacific is expected to witness strong growth in the next five years. Also, demand across the region is reinforced by the emerging markets, namely China and India.
